Knobelsdorff is a Minnesota-based industrial electrical contractor providing automation and controls, electrical construction, renewable energy EPC (including utility-scale solar and BESS), and comprehensive power services and testing. The company delivers UL panel building, MES/IIoT integrations via its TerraKE™ platform, turnkey design-build projects, and 24/7 emergency support for customers in food & beverage, grain/feed/flour, industrial processing, mining, data centers and other industrial markets. Knobelsdorff emphasizes sustainability, safety, and long-term partnerships while offering engineering, procurement, construction, operations & maintenance, and preventative maintenance for electrical systems.
